I didn’t do it. It wasn’t me. Honest! I didn’t even attempt anything we just had a nice BBQ.

It all started around a month ago. I heard Ura and the Ura-Clan were going to be in the area, so I invited them over for a BBQ. I even offered to let them stay the night. Shame they didn’t take me up on that. I prepared the guest bedroom just for them. Oh well, my mother-in-law will be visiting in a few months. I’m sure everything will keep until then.

I did my utmost to be a courteous host, and I even made special ribs with no “Extra Spices” for Ura and his brood. Mind you we had a few other guests over too, and I did prepare some food with the “extra spices” for them (long story, lets just say that there was a little matter of money being owed, which I don’t owe them now). But I made it abundantly clear to Ura and Shesa that those particular ribs had the “extra spices” and that Ura and Shesa along with their two heroes in training were to stay away from them.

We all sat at the table and ate steamed crabs, ribs and steak, had cheesecake and drank a couple of bottles of Ice Wine while we reminisced about old times, and got caught up with what’s been happening. I even got out the gold silverware. It was a very nice visit. I was very impressed with Shesa Hero too she was quite the lady the entire night.

After we ate, our youngest kids went downstairs and showed Ura Jr his explosives collection and taught him how to combine smaller explosives into a much larger and more powerful explosive. No permanent harm was done to the yard, and fences can be replaced. They both had a good time and that was important. Afterward they played a few games of pool.

Now I’d like to note that Ura Hero Jr’s S/L resistance is quite high for one so young. Seems my youngest had an “accident” and broke a pool stick. Oh sure, he said it just magically broke all by itself, but I saw Ura Jr rubbing his head. I’m pretty sure Ace Jr blindsided him with it while he had his back turned.

I think they both learned a very important lesson out of the whole deal. Ura Jr learned not to turn his back on people, and Ace Jr. learned to use a bigger stick, and to think of better excuses. *Sigh* it does me good to see life lessons learned at such a tender age.

I came back upstairs after what we’re calling the “pool stick incident” only too see Ura gulping down his second rib with the “extra spices” I’m pretty sure Shesa gave them to him.

By the way, my dog absolutely adored Shesa, and he’s a great judge of character, just proves once again he’s right.

All in all a very pleasant BBQ, but eventually it had to end. They packed up the kids and we all said our goodbyes. I told Ura to visit the hospital if he started feeling queasy, then again I might have said not to visit the hospital. My memories are kind of fuzzy on that point. I do remember giving him a bunch of leftovers, along with the rest of the cheesecake. I hope they enjoyed them.

I made sure that Ura Jr got a box of explosives (it was Independence Day after all) and told him not to combine them, and not to set them off outside mom and dad’s room at 2 am. I also told him not to set the explosives off in the car. Ura Jr. was such a well behaved boy I’m sure he followed my instructions to the letter just like all teenagers would. I did however hear an explosion in the general direction they were going shortly after they got out of sight followed up by several sirens...

All in all it was a very pleasant visit, and I can honestly say that the last time I saw Ura, Shesa and the rest of the Ura-Clan they were well fed and in perfect health. Does my heart good to throw a successful BBQ like that.

I survived another round with my arch-nemesis, Golden Ace. I knew something was up when he invited me over to his house so quickly after being informed that I would be in the area. There were promises of a "BBQ" and "stay the night, please" being thrown around in a weak attempt to lure me in.

Of course any offer of free food is something that even a hardened soul such as myself would have trouble turning down, so I went ahead and accepted the offer. Who doesn't like free food???

We were told to show up fashionably late. I assume this was so that he would have time to set up all of the traps and poison. Try as I might I never did see a single trap and as for poison all I got was some gas and a bit of indigestion.

Like any good host he met us at the door with his minions in tow. I was surprised that there were only three. Most villainous figures have dozens due to loosing them to unfortunate accidents. Perhaps that is why there were only three. This could also explain the lack of traps and poison. The other minions had tested the devices and found them to be working and GA didn't have time to set more.

His wife was quite a nice lady. I thought at first she was being held against her will what with all of the cooking she was doing, but I later found out that she was trying to turn him to the good side. It seemed to be working as I heard him say, "Yes dear" several times. Given a few more years of work, she might just manage to make him a model citizen.

The time came to eat. And eat we did. Ribs, steak, crabs, salad, rice, it was all delicious. I ate too much. Shesa ate too much. The sidekicks ate too much. Frankly after the first few mouthfuls, I forgot about checking for poison. And then there was the cheesecake. Homemade cheesecake. Arrgghh. I had to force myself to eat it, but somehow I managed to get it down along with a chocolate pudding dessert cup. And a few more ribs.

I was chatting along with GA when I realized that the timers on the traps I had set were getting short. I hurriedly made some poor excuse to leave and tried to make it out before anything armed itself. GA did his best to delay us, but we finally managed to make it out alive.

It was fun, but I was a bit disappointed that there weren't any traps to dodge or disarm. And as far as poisons go I think my dad was right. A gallon of buttermilk before drinking anything vile will disarm the effects.

At least we did our part to put a dent in his food supply.

BTW, the ribs were still delicious reheated on Wednesday night along with the cheesecake remains.

Thanks for a great time GA.
